Bio-Detek Recalls ZOLL Pro-padz Sterile Adult Electrodes Due to Sterility Concerns
Bio-Detek, Inc. is recalling ZOLL Pro-padz Sterile Adult Multi-Function Electrodes because product sterility is not assured. The recall affects 41 single units distributed worldwide.

Plain-English summary
Bio-Detek, Inc. is recalling ZOLL Pro-padz Sterile Adult Multi-Function Electrodes with 10-ft (3 m) leadwires, part number 8900-4055-40. The recall is being conducted because product sterility is not assured. These disposable, single-use electrodes are intended for use in a sterile environment by trained medical professionals in connection with ZOLL Defibrillators for adult patients.
The affected product includes 41 single units from lot numbers 1614, 1914, and 2114. The products were distributed worldwide, including in the United States, Australia, Canada, Belgium, France, and Germany. The electrodes are used for defibrillation, cardioversion, external non-invasive pacing, and monitoring.
Healthcare facilities and consumers should stop using the affected electrodes and contact Bio-Detek, Inc. for further instructions or a return. The recall is classified as Class II by the FDA, indicating a reasonable probability that the use of the product may cause temporary or medically reversible adverse health consequences.
